Nota
L'accés a aquesta pàgina requereix autorització. Podeu provar d'iniciar la sessió o de canviar els directoris.
L'accés a aquesta pàgina requereix autorització. Podeu provar de canviar els directoris.
Important
A partir de l'1 de maig de 2026, el feed d'agents només admet agents que utilitzen el Power Apps MCP Server per crear tasques. Assegura't que els teus agents estiguin ben integrats al servidor MCP Power Apps per llavors continuar utilitzant el flux d'agents. Si els teus agents no utilitzen el Power Apps MCP Server, el feed d'agents no apareix a l'aplicació basada en models. Més informació: Incorpora el teu feed d'agent per utilitzar el servidor Power Apps MCP
El protocol de context del model (MCP) és un protocol obert que permet una integració fluida entre aplicacions de grans models de llenguatge (LLM) i fonts i eines de dades externes. El teu agent pot utilitzar el Power Apps MCP Server per comunicar-se amb els teus Power Apps, proporcionant una supervisió adequada de les persones en el bucle o fluxos de treball agents.
Important
- Aquesta és una característica de visualització prèvia.
- Les característiques de visualització prèvia no estan pensades per a l'ús de producció i poden tenir una funcionalitat restringida. Aquestes funcions estan subjectes a termes d'ús suplementaris, i estan disponibles abans d'una versió oficial perquè els clients puguin obtenir access primerenc i donar comentaris.
- Aquesta funció només està disponible en anglès i substitueix l'anterior feed d'agents basat en activitats de Microsoft Copilot Studio.
- Per a informació sobre com s'utilitza la IA amb aquesta funció, consulteu FAQ sobre Power Apps eina de invoke_data_entry MCP Server.
El Power Apps MCP Server equipa el teu agent amb dos tipus de capacitats:
Automatitzar tasques repetitives de l'aplicació:
El Power Apps MCP Server permet als agents utilitzar eines avançades d'aplicacions desenvolupades amb Power Apps. Per exemple, les capacitats d'agent d'entrada de dades que abans estaven disponibles com a funcionalitat d'IA sota demanda ara són accessibles per a qualsevol agent a través del servidor Power Apps MCP. Per utilitzar-los, crees el teu agent, configures l'eina MCP i el dirigeixes a contingut no estructurat perquè pugui generar registres de Dataverse amb revisió i aprovació humana a través del feed millorat de l'agent.
Supervisa l'activitat de l'agent:
El Power Apps MCP Server també proporciona eines especialitzades als usuaris de negoci per supervisar qualsevol activitat d'agent en el feed d'agents. Ara els agents poden transferir el control a humans per a la seva revisió, assistència i orientació amb les eines MCP. Aquestes eines ofereixen als creadors molt més control sobre les tasques que volen publicar al feed de l'agent i quan necessiten el traspàs agent-humà.
Nota
L'accés al flux d'agents i a les capacitats de supervisió està limitat per defecte als rols d'Administrador del Sistema i Personalitzador del Sistema. Per permetre que més usuaris puguin veure el feed de l'agent, concedeix permisos de lectura/escriptura a nivell d'organització a les taules que es llisten aquí. Pots crear un nou rol de seguretat amb aquests permisos i assignar el rol a diversos usuaris segons calgui.
- Objectiu de l'Agent Hub (agent hubgoal)
- Agent Hub Insight (agenthubinsight)
- Agent Hub Metric (agenthubmetric)
- Agent Task(agenttask)
- Copilot(bot)
Les eines MCP de Power Apps milloren com més les utilitzes. Per exemple, quan fas correccions a suggeriments a l'agent canvas, l'eina d'entrada de dades millora segons les teves correccions. Per utilitzar les capacitats millorades del feed d'agents, activa i configura el servidor MCP de Power Apps des de l'agent Microsoft Copilot Studio. Un cop configurat, pots invocar les eines del servidor MCP de Power Apps a partir d'instruccions de l'agent utilitzant llenguatge natural.
Més informació: Crea un agent autònom connectat a Power Apps servidor MCP
Incorpora el teu agent per utilitzar el servidor MCP de Power Apps
Per configurar un agent existent que estava a la versió anterior del feed d'agents perquè utilitzi el servidor MCP de Power Apps, has de fer el següent:
Afegeix el servidor MCP de Power Apps al teu agent. Per fer-ho, obre l'agent a Copilot Studio i després selecciona Afegir eina.
Actualitza les instruccions de l'agent perquè utilitzis cadascuna de les eines del Power Apps MCP Server en els moments adequats de la seva orquestració. Hi ha exemples de com fer-ho a la resta d'aquest document.
Desa i publica el teu agent.
Important
En escenaris d'agent autònom on un agent s'executa mitjançant un trigger, el servidor MCP de Power Apps ha d'estar configurat per funcionar amb "credencials proporcionades pel Maker", tal com es veu a la secció de detalls de l'eina. Ves a les credencials proporcionades pel creador de Control per a l'autenticació per a més detalls si aquesta opció està desactivada.
Llista d'eines
Un cop connectat al Power Apps MCP Server, l'agent pot triar entre diverses eines de l'entorn Power Platform. Aquestes eines poden generar elements del feed d'agents que generen diferents experiències d'usuari, com ara una vista costat a costat per als agents d'entrada de dades o la navegació directa a un registre d'escenaris request_for_assistance .
| Eina | Descripció |
|---|---|
| log_for_review | Registra l'activitat completada per a la supervisió passiva humana. |
| request_assistance | Sol·licita assistència a un usuari humà. |
| invoke_data_entry | Crea un o més registres en una font de dades com Microsoft Dataverse, utilitzant continguts de text pla o d'un correu electrònic. |
log_for_review
Registres completats del treball de l'agent al feed de l'agent per a la seva revisió. L'eina log_for_review està pensada per a escenaris on un agent té prou informació per actuar de manera autònoma però l'usuari hauria de ser informat del que ha fet l'agent. Aquesta eina es pot considerar com una manera de supervisar passivament les accions d'alta confiança o de baix risc realitzades pels agents. És més adequat per a decisions que es poden revisar o revertir fàcilment si l'agent realitza l'acció incorrectament. A més del títol, la descripció i els passos, també pots demanar a l'eina que afegeixi un enllaç al registre rellevant de Dataverse o a una URL externa a l'aplicació. Si una acció d'agent toca diversos registres de Dataverse, pots indicar a quin registre ha de navegar en relació amb la tasca creada. Podria ser l'enllaç al registre que l'agent va crear utilitzant el servidor MCP de Dataverse o un enllaç de registre present en context, com el registre que va desencadenar l'execució de l'agent. Aquestes tasques es mostren a la pestanya Completat del feed de l'agent.
Exemple d'instrucció
Quan el client fa una reserva des del portal, aquest agent ha d'anotar les dades per a la revisió. El títol de l'article de la ressenya ha d'estar basat en el número de referència de la reserva i ha d'utilitzar exactament el prefix "Review Web Booking: ". A la descripció de la ressenya, escriu un resum concís de la reserva que inclogui camps principals com Referència de Reserva, Data de Reserva, Número de seient i Estat, perquè un revisor pugui entendre ràpidament què s'ha processat sense haver d'obrir el registre. Assegura't que la descripció sigui un paràgraf curt i reflecteixi amb precisió els valors actuals del registre de la reserva. Inclou el teu raonament com a passos. També, inclou un enllaç al registre de la reserva.
request_assistance
L'objectiu de l'eina request_assistance és permetre als agents posar a la llum errors, escalades o excepcions als usuaris, perquè puguin prendre les accions adequades. Com a creador, pots definir els escenaris per fer que el teu agent utilitzi l'eina request_assistance . Crea una tasca del feed d'agents que es troba a la secció Needs Attention del feed d'agents. Aquesta és una operació asíncrona que crida l'agent de Microsoft Copilot Studio que espera fins que l'humà acabi l'acció. Per a més detalls sobre com completar l'activitat del feed d'accions, ves a Supervisar agents en aplicacions basades en models amb feed d'agents (previsualització)
Pots observar l'estat en curs de l'agent executar-se a la pestanya d'activitat quan visualitzis l'agent a Copilot Studio. Un cop l'usuari completa l'activitat del feed de l'agent, el control torna a l'agent mitjançant callback i l'agent pot completar la tasca.
Com amb l'eina log_for_review , pots controlar la sortida de la tasca pel títol, la descripció i els passos, i pots ser específic a l'hora de dir a l'agent quin enllaç associar a una tasca determinada.
Exemple d'instrucció
Quan aquest agent es veu activat per la creació d'un nou cas de suport, hauria de sol·licitar assistència. A la petició, posa el títol prefixant el valor de l'emissió amb "Assistència necessària: ". A la descripció de la tasca inclou el tipus de problema, la descripció del problema, la data de notificació i el valor resolt. Inclou els teus passos de raonament. També inclou un enllaç al registre d'emissions relacionat de Dataverse. Un cop l'usuari ha completat la tasca, continua el processament posant l'estat del cas a Tancat.
Dissenya el teu usuari en el bucle
Abans d'escriure les instruccions del teu agent, decideix on pertany la supervisió humana en el teu flux de treball. Utilitza les preguntes següents per identificar quins moments s'han d'utilitzar request_assistance, quins han d'utilitzar log_for_review, i quins l'agent pot gestionar de manera autònoma.
| Pregunta | Orientació | Eina |
|---|---|---|
| On hi ha més en joc? | Els resultats d'alt risc requereixen supervisió independentment de la confiança de l'agent. Dóna instruccions explícites a l'agent perquè faci una pausa. | request_assistance |
| Quan és sempre necessària la intervenció de l'usuari? | Si pots expressar-ho com a norma, codifica-ho directament a les instruccions de l'agent. | request_assistance |
| Quins inputs varien de manera imprevisible? | Les dades no estructurades, els casos límit i les situacions noves no sempre es poden anticipar. Indica a l'agent que surti dinàmicament aquests aspectes. | request_assistance |
| L'agent necessita una resposta per continuar? | Si l'agent és bloquejat sense intervenció humana, hauria d'esperar una resposta. Si pot continuar i després una audiència humana fa una audiència, no hauria de fer-ho. |
request_assistance si sí, log_for_review si no |
| L'usuari és propietari del resultat? | Els requisits de compliment, les aprovacions d'alt valor o les decisions de política poden requerir una aprovació humana fins i tot quan l'agent està segur. | log_for_review |
Propina
Un agent ben dissenyat no demana ajuda constantment. En canvi, pregunta en els moments adequats. Fes servir request_assistance amb moderació per a qüestions de decisió genuïnes, i deixa log_for_review que la resta.
Exemples d'instruccions per patró
Regla explícita:
"Per a qualsevol reclamació amb una pèrdua estimada superior a 5.000 dòlars, utilitza
request_assistanceper redirigir la reclamació al perit assignat abans de continuar."
Judici dinàmic:
"Si la causa de la pèrdua és ambigua o els documents de la reclamació entren en conflicte, utilitza-ho
request_assistanceper marcar la reclamació perquè l'ajustador la revisi."
Supervisió passiva:
"Després de completar la determinació de cobertura, utilitza
log_for_reviewper registrar el resultat i confirmar que la reclamació ha estat aprovada per avançar."
Exemple: Agent de determinació de pòlissa d'assegurança de la llar
L'exemple següent mostra com aquests patrons s'apliquen a un flux de treball complet i real.
L'agent s'activa automàticament quan es presenta una nova reclamació. Extreu la pòlissa, els avals i els documents de suport rellevants de Dataverse, i després els justifica per produir una determinació de cobertura, comprovant si la pòlissa estava activa, si el perill reclamat està cobert i si algun conflicte de documents afecta la confiança en el resultat.
A partir d'aquí, l'agent utilitza el servidor MCP de Power Apps per mostrar resultats al feed de l'agent basant-se en el que ha trobat. Si la reclamació és ambigua, conflictiva o requereix el judici de l'ajustador, l'agent l'utilitza request_assistance per crear una tasca per a l'ajustador assignat amb el context que necessita per actuar. Si la reclamació és clara, l'agent registra log_for_review passivament el resultat i no cal cap acció. Quan un ajustador completa una tasca, l'agent reprèn, llegeix la decisió, actualitza el registre de la reclamació i registra un avís de finalització al feed.
El resultat és un flux de treball on l'agent gestiona el volum rutinari de manera autònoma i només recull una persona en punts de decisió genuïns amb prou context perquè l'ajustador pugui actuar immediatament.
invoke_data_entry
L'eina invoke_data_entry agilitza la creació de registres de Dataverse extraient informació estructurada d'entrades no estructurades com correus electrònics, missatges o documents. Quan s'invoca des d'un agent de Copilot Studio, analitza automàticament el contingut entrant, omple el formulari corresponent amb les dades extretes i presenta l'entrada proposada com una tasca al feed de l'agent per a la revisió i aprovació dels usuaris. Requereix la revisió de l'entrada proposada per part de l'usuari abans de crear el registre. Els registres mai no es creen automàticament amb l'eina invoke_data_entry . Això permet una captura de dades ràpida i fiable amb un esforç manual mínim.
Exemple d'instrucció: agent activat per correu compartit
Ets l'agent generador d'idees de viatge. La teva feina és processar correus entrants i crear registres d'idees de viatge a Dataverse.
Quan arriba un correu electrònic:
Determina si conté informació relacionada amb el viatge (ja sigui al cos del correu electrònic o als arxius adjunts).
Utilitza l'eina
invoke_data_entryper crear un registre d'idees de viatge amb la informació extreta a les següents columnes:- cr3ea_title
- cr3ea_description
- cr3ea_triptype
- cr3ea_customername
- cr3ea_customeremail
- cr3ea_customerphone
- cr3ea_destinationcity
- cr3ea_travelstart
- cr3ea_travelend
- cr3ea_numberoftravelers
- cr3ea_budgetusd
- cr3ea_specialrequests
Si falta informació, igualment crea el registre amb les dades disponibles: deixa camps desconeguts buits.
Nota
- Quan escriguis instruccions per al teu agent, sempre referencia les columnes de Dataverse pels seus noms lògics tal com es mostra a la instrucció d'exemple. Instruccions clares i directes ajuden l'agent a crear registres de manera fiable a partir de l'entrada. Pots veure el nom lògic d'una columna obrint la taula a make.powerapps.com, seleccionant Columnes i després obrint la columna per veure els detalls.
-
invoke_data_entryL'eina admet formats .pdf, .xlsx, .docx, .jpeg, .jpg, .png, .gif and.bmp. -
invoke_data_entryl'eina pot omplir una sola línia de text (format Null), nombres enters i tipus de columna decimal. - Assegura't que l'usuari tingui permís per crear registres per a la taula objectiu.
Com funciona l'eina invoke_data_entry
Quan configures un agent Copilot Studio per utilitzar el servidor MCP Power Apps i activar l'eina invoke_data_entry, l'agent segueix aquest procés:
- Un agent trigger s'activa segons la teva configuració — com ara un correu electrònic que arriba a una bústia monitoritzada o un nou document pujat a SharePoint.
- L'agent analitza el contingut entrant i les teves instruccions per determinar si s'ha d'utilitzar l'eina
invoke_data_entry. - Si cal, s'invoca l'eina
invoke_data_entry, passant el contingut d'entrada i les columnes de taula i taula de Dataverse destinació per predir. - L'eina processa l'entrada, extreu la informació rellevant i omple un formulari Dataverse amb valors suggerits per a cada columna mapejada.
- Apareix una tasca al feed de l'agent. Seleccionar-lo obre l'experiència de revisió d'entrada de dades. El panell esquerre mostra l'entrada original, i el panell dret mostra el formulari omplert amb valors suggerits.
- L'usuari pot revisar els valors extrets, fer correccions si cal i després desar el registre a Dataverse.
Proporcionar comentaris
Per donar feedback sobre l'eina invoke_data_entry:
- Obre una tasca invoke_data_entry al feed de l'agent.
- Selecciona el botó de retroalimentació a l'encapçalament de la tasca.
- Tria fer un compliment, informar d'un problema o fer una suggerència.
Articles relacionats
Afegeix agents a la teva aplicació orientada al model (previsualització)
Supervisar agents en aplicacions basades en models amb feed d'agents (previsualització)